Oswego Man Charged With Attempted Murder

On Thursday (June 7) at approximately 2:45 p.m., members of the Oswego County Sheriff’s Office and New York State Police responded to a possible stabbing outside the DSS building in the village of Mexico. Upon arrival, a male victim was found with a stab wound to the head. The suspect, Steven M. Haynes, of Oswego, was located in the town of Mexico and taken into custody.

Hundreds Turn Out To Christen Oswego’s Dog Park

Moments after the Port City’s newest park was opened, it was filled with scores of canines running happily inside the two enclosures; sniffing all over while making new friends. The dogs, large and small and just about every bred imaginable romped in the playground built just for them – without any altercations. It prompted one pet owner to remark, “If only people could get along as well.” Oswego’s Dog Park is located at 375 Mitchell St., on the city’s east side.

Mexico Valedictorian, Salutatorian Reflect On Experiences

History has repeated itself for Mexico High School seniors Ashton Ariola and Angel Newcombe. While the pair was named the top two students of their eighth grade class at Mexico Middle School; four years later they also landed at the top of the Mexico High School Class of 2018 in their respective valedictorian and salutatorian posts.
